Lightning deals can be found by clicking the little Gold Box icon at the top of Amazon's website. There is a red link that says "Black Friday Deals Are Here" at the very top right corner of Amazon too- I would have that open whenever you are at a computer through Cyber Monday and click through in advance to see the times and what items will be available.

To get them you need to be there the second the timers hit zero. People were napping on Thanksgiving Day, but now they are all over the deals to where they sell out in 15 secs. Happy Hunting :toast:
